I found myself loving the exploration of the path-less-traveled. I always found it very cool to lay eyes upon a place that has been vacant of any human save for the ones such as ourselves. The places forever forgotten or taken for granted are always fascinating. Or the infrastructure such as drains, the places not even known about by most "surface-dwellers". The history that goes into the old abandoned mine in the desolate mountains or the drain underneath the busiest streets is a story often not told, and I am the one who ends up seeking, listening to these stories. It's always quite so fascinating.

Part of it for me is seeing something completely falling apart and thinking that people once worked here and were proud to, or that a family once lived here, had birthdays and Christmases and it was their home not a pile of beyond repair scrap wood. Even when it comes to an old car, thinking that someone once bought this brand new and were so excited about it and showed it off and now nobody does. Every time I am exploring I look around and can almost see what was there, the heart of it, the way it was before something happened and just like that it was forgotten. Reading this back it sounds kinda depressing, but I don't mean it to be, visiting these places, learning the history, imagining how it was to me gives them a little bit of life back where everyone else just sees an eyesore.

Plus it so so much fun and such a rush being where you are not supposed to be
